Russian landing ships headed back to Syria

Turkish sources reported that two large landing ship  Project 775 - Novocherkassk and Korolev, with a cargo of military purpose, once again passed the Bosphorus, heading for Syria.

Ukraine showed KVADRAT-2D mobile surface-to-air missile system at MSPO-2015

During  MSPO 2015, 23rd International Defence Industry Exhibition 2015  was shown a modernized air defense systems 2K12-2D KVADRAT-2D by  Ukrainian state company Ukroboronservice.
